Time to replace my LF Shane - how about a Murray?
 
I’m an intermediate boat rider, 220lbs. My 10 or 11 year old LF Shane 140 is falling apart so I need a new ride. I’ve not kept up at all with board development and don’t have a clue about current models. There’s no possibility to demo so I’d welcome some advice. Woukd a Murray 150 make sense?

Many thanks for your thoughts.9

At 220 I'd pretty easily say going to the 150 would be a fun move for you. I'm 150, 5'6" and ride the 144 sometimes. Go w the Murray. That's what I ride:)

I think you might like the 150. I'm 5'11" 175 and love my 144. Going to try the 150 soon and see how that feels. At 220, I would say 150cm for sure.

For the price, the Murray is hard to beat. It's a solid board that hardly ever gets a bad review. I'm 205-210 and went with the 150. In full disclosure, mine cracked the second time I rode it. I got it at the end of the season last year. They replaced it with a 2019 model, but it didn't come in time to try it out before winter. I'm chalking my failure up to some kind of one off defect in the manufacturing process.
